Legatee22 Oct 1826  Moses Buchanan (Sr.'s) will left Moses an equal share of his father's estate with his sisters Elizabeth, Jane and Margaret, and his brothers James and Philip. His older brothers Hastings, Mathew and John received their father's lands and mill.1 
Fath-Death8 Apr 1827  Moses was most likely no more than a year old when his father died on 8 Apr 1827. 
Ward22 Nov 1841 On 22 Nov 1841 Moses and his brother Philip were named wards of Washington J. Bishop.3 
Legatee6 Feb 1858  Joanna Buchanan wrote her will in February, 1858. She left the land on which she lived and the bulk of her estate to her son Philip, who had remained on the family farm with her. Moses and his other siblings each received $5.00.2

  1. [S618] Moses Buchanan will (exhibited 21 June 1827/ 17 Jul. 1827), Washington Co., Virginia, Will Book 5: 356. The will was written 22 Oct. 1826. It mentioned wife Joanna, sons Hastings, Mathew, John, James, Philip and daughters Margaret, Elizabeth and Jane (Buchanan); also brother William and youngest child Moses Campbell Buchanan. The witnesses were James Edmondson and Samuel Edmondson. As no executor was named Joanna Buchanan was appt administrix. She posted bond in the amt of $5,000 with William Buchanan, John Katron, Robert Keys and James Edmondson providing security.
